Are major online platforms such as Facebook, Instagram, X, YouTube, and TikTok engaged in censoring accounts or deliberately limiting the visibility of pro-Palestine content? Numerous social media users are claiming that a practice commonly referred to as shadowbanning is at play. Writers, activists, journalists, filmmakers, and everyday users worldwide have reported that platforms are concealing posts featuring hashtags such as “FreePalestine” and “IStandWithPalestine,” along with messages expressing solidarity with civilian Palestinians, who have been under siege for the past two months.
